  7. Vitamin D - Wikipedia

    en.wikipedia.org/wiki/Vitamin_D

    Serum 25(OH)D concentration is used as a biomarker for vitamin D deficiency. Units of measurement are either ng/mL or nmol/L, with one ng/mL equal to 2.5 nmol/L. There is no consensus on defining vitamin D deficiency, insufficiency, sufficiency, or optimal for all aspects of health. [19]

  9. Ergocalciferol - Wikipedia

    en.wikipedia.org/wiki/Ergocalciferol

    Ergocalciferol, also known as vitamin D 2 and nonspecifically calciferol, is a type of vitamin D found in food. It is used as a dietary supplement [3] to prevent and treat vitamin D deficiency [4] due to poor absorption by the intestines or liver disease. [5]
